About CHETTINAD COLLEGE OF ENGINEERING & TECHNOLOGY

Chettinad College of Engineering and Technology (CCET), located in the industrial hub of Karur, Tamil Nadu, was established in 2007 under the aegis of the Chettinad Educational Trust. Over the past two decades, the institution has emerged as a premier center for technical education, committed to transforming students into competent, innovative, and ethically grounded engineering professionals. Affiliated with Anna University, Chennai, and approved by the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E), the college offers a comprehensive range of undergraduate (B.E./B.Tech) and postgraduate (MBA, M.E.) programs. Admission Process

Admissions are primarily merit-based through the TNEA (Tamil Nadu Engineering Admissions) counseling process; management quota admissions are processed as per state government and university norms.
